Study On The Planning And Optimization Of Bus And HOV3+ Composite Lane

For the urban transportation system,both HOV priority and bus priority can effectively alleviate the contradiction between the insufficient supply of transportation facilities and the increasing travel demand.At present,some of the leading cities in China have started to introduce the concept of HOV priority into bus lanes,and build complex and intensive public transport dedicated HOV Shared lanes.In this way,HOV behaviors are taken into account while ensuring bus priority,which effectively alleviates the problems of uneven distribution of road resources such as traffic lane congestion and vacant bus lanes.At present,there are few studies in the academic circle on the Shared lane of HOV dedicated for public transportation,and the research Angle is mostly qualitative evaluation.Only a rough judgment can be made on whether the congestion can be reduced,without systematic analysis of its road characteristics and operating efficiency,and no unified standard has been formed in planning and construction.Therefore,this paper studies the planning setup and optimization of 3+HOV Shared lanes for public transport.First of all,this article from the bus special HOV lanes definition involves sharing lane,in combing the domestic and foreign present research situation and development of HOV lanes and bus lanes,on the basis of dynamic analysis of the limitations of the present theory and practice,pointed out the developing potential of Shared lanes,Shared lanes planning is put forward the necessity of the establishment and evaluation methods.Secondly,based on the investigation,the paper summarizes the macro characteristics of the mixed land forms and perfect road network layout of 3 + HOV Shared lanes for bus use in dalian city,as well as the micro characteristics of the road conditions being restricted by the environment.Taking the software park road as the local research object,the basic parameters of the road and vehicle operation data are investigated in detail to analyze its spatial and temporal distribution law and traffic operation state.Then,based on the survey data of software park road,the micro simulation model is constructed by using the traffic flow simulation evaluation method.Taking the number of people transported in section,the average travel time,the average delay time and the average speed of time as the evaluation indexes,the implementation effect before and after the establishment of Shared lanes was evaluated.The results showed that after the opening of the Shared lane,the speed difference between the bus lane and the common lane was reduced to about 50% before the opening,the number of people transporting the section was increased by about 10%,the average travel time was shortened by 4.27%,and the average delay time was shortened by 10.98%.It proved that the Shared lane could save residents' travel time and improve the overall operation efficiency of the road.Thirdly,in order to further improve the operation efficiency of the Shared lane on the software park road,based on the current model,six schemes were designed for comprehensive comparative evaluation in the two directions of changing the number of HOV carriers and changing the signal timing,so as to explore the lane setting form with the optimal traffic efficiency.Among them,the scheme of setting up a 2+ Shared lane when the signal is optimized and matched has the strongest ability to reduce road saturation,save per capita travel time,improve average speed and transport number.Finally,combined with the data and conclusions of traffic survey,efficiency evaluation and optimization scheme of software park road,the setting conditions of Shared lanes were studied by referring to the domestic and foreign bus lanes and HOV lane setting specifications.At the same time,considering the impact of land use and traffic environment differences on Shared lanes,the paper puts forward planning Suggestions from the aspects of macro layout,micro design and traffic management.Based on the traffic survey data,this paper constructs a model to evaluate the operation efficiency of 3+ Shared lanes on software park road,explores the optimization scheme,and studies the setting conditions of Shared lanes.It theoretically makes up for the lack of the study on the evaluation and planning setting of Shared lanes at the present stage,and provides reference data for the improvement of the implementation scheme of Shared lanes in practice.
